Firbolgs get the Firbolg Magic trait (VGtM, p. 107), which lets them cast Detect Magic. Normally, Detect Magic is able to be cast as a ritual.
Can this version be cast by a Druid as a ritual, or can it only be cast normally as a free once-a-day spell?

Your Firbolg Druid cannot cast their racial Detect Magic as a ritual
The rules for ritual casting are given in the Spellcasting chapter of the basic rules:
The key paragraph is the second one, laying out the requirements to be able to cast a given spell as a ritual:
Firbolgs do not inherently have any trait which allows ritual casting, so they cannot cast any rituals by default. But your Firbolg is a druid with the druid's Spellcasting feature - which allows them to cast certain rituals:
Unfortunately this doesn't allow them to cast Detect Magic as a ritual, because the Firbolg Magic trait says:
... but it doesn't state that you have them prepared in a spellcasting sense - you simply have a special ability which allows you to produce their effects once per rest. Since the spell is not prepared, it doesn't qualify for use with the druid's ritual spellcasting - to be able to cast it as a ritual, you'd have to prepare it as a druid spell and use up the space on your prepared spells list.
